Associate in Natural Resources Management and Policy in Montana


Associate degrees in Natural Resources Management and Policy:  A program that prepares individuals to plan, develop, manage, and evaluate programs to protect and regulate natural habitats and renewable natural resources. Includes instruction in the principles of wildlife and conservation biology, environmental science, animal population surveying, natural resource economics, management techniques for various habitats, applicable law and policy, administrative and communications skills, and public relations.

Blackfeet Community College

While Natural Resource Programs at the mainstream institutions provide excellent technical and practical education, none incorporate Blackfeet cultural values as an integral part of the curricula. The results are technicians inadequately trained to work in a reservation setting where local cultures may differ on Natural Resource Management philosophy. Blackfeet Community College‘s curriculum design, on the other hand, directly addresses cultural values...

Fort Belknap College

The goal of the Natural Resources Program is designed to provide skills for entry-level employment opportunities and continuation of education in forestry, fish and wildlife management, biology, water quality, soil conservation and range conservation. The student will acquire a basic knowledge of natural resources, environmental issues, and traditional cultural values. ...
